Description
Technical field
The present invention relates to a kind of steel wire processing unit (plant), is a kind of I-beam wheel automatic packing apparatus specifically.
Background technology
Steel bead wire is the various interaction forces for bearing between tire and wheel rim, tire is fixed on wheel rim closely, during transport, steel bead wire is wound in I-beam wheel and transports, due to the chemical nature that it is special, be easy to get rusty and corrode in natural environment, cause steel bead wire to be scrapped, therefore steel wire anticorrosion packaging is indispensable link in producing.
Two-layer wrapper is adopted to be wound on Steel Wire Surface to I-beam wheel rust prevention packaging, PE film winding on the wrapper, steel bead wire and outside air are isolated, prevent from getting rusty, traditional manner of packing adopts artificial hand-held wrapper, PE film reels, and need a large amount of manpower, not only labour intensity is large, easily cause personal injury, and in packaging process, PE film wraps that effect is poor causes that leak tightness is not good causes steel wire corrosion.

Detailed description of the invention
As shown in Figure 1, I-beam wheel automatic packing apparatus, comprise base 1, support 2, described support 2 is arranged on base 1, the side of described support 2 is disposed with cutting device 3 and workpiece turning gear 4 from top to bottom, the opposite side of described support 2 is disposed with pay-off 5 from top to bottom, control setup 6 and fixing device 7, described pay-off 5 is arranged on support 2 by material turning gear 8, described pay-off 5 is also provided with magazine 9, the bottom of described magazine 9 and cutting device 3 are in same level, the axle center of described fixing device 7 and the axle center of workpiece turning gear 4 are in same level, described clamping fills 7 and is set up and is provided with I-beam wheel 10, the top of described I-beam wheel 10 is corresponding with magazine 9, and be provided with between magazine 9 and I-beam wheel 10 and echo device 11, the base 1 of the below of described I-beam wheel 10 is provided with lifting device 12.
Principle of work of the present invention: I-beam wheel 10 is lifted specified altitude assignment by lifting device 12, fixing device clamps I-beam wheel 10, wrapper is delivered to assigned address by pay-off 5, echo device 11 and push down wrapper, workpiece turning gear 4 rotates, I-beam wheel 10 is packed, after cutting device 3 severing wrapper, pay-off 5 send overpack paper to formulation position, echo device 11 and push down wrapper, workpiece turning gear 12 rotates to be packed, after cutting device 3 severing wrapper, adhesive tape is delivered to and is formulated position by pay-off 5, laminating apparatus pushes down adhesive tape, material turning gear 8 rotates paper of taping, after cutting device severing, once pack, save manpower, avoid employee because of misoperation generation safety misadventure.
